Step 1
Heat the olive oil in a large deep frying pan on medium-high heat. Add the garlic and cook to soften, but not quite brown.
Step 2
Add the spinach and sauté with the garlic until wilted. Season with salt and pepper, remove from heat and set aside.
Step 3
Cook the pasta according to the package instructions. Reserve a cup of the pasta water before draining. Drain, and set aside.
Step 4
Add the spinach and garlic mixture to a food processor or blender with the cheese and half of the pasta water. Puree until it forms a sauce (adding more pasta water if needed).
Step 5
Add the sauce back into the pan to combine and heat through, again adding more pasta water if needed.
Step 6
Once heated through, taste and season with more salt and pepper if necessary. Serve sprinkled with extra grated cheese.
